Stay and Play January 2010
The ITA is proud to introduce the Stay and Play system of teaching to our younger players and beginner adults. This system ensures success from day one. Players feel like they are playing real tennis. This is most important especially to our younger players. Thank you to our Head coach Lazarus Manjoro for all the training we received last year. Lazarus was a National coach from Zimbabwe who joined the academy to raise the standard of our teaching in 2010 and assist us with the successful implementation of the Stay and play program.  This program is international adn endorsed by the ITF who now runs all training in SA. This means all staff can teach anywhere in the world once they are ITF qualified.

Stay and Play Workshop Gauteng 13-15 March  12.03.09
Business owner and school teacher, Michele Joyce will attend this course and continue the training schedule with her staff in order to continue with the successful implementation of this game-based approach . The ITA is very excited about this and the children have loved the new activities this term. This program is very beneficial for all school sports teachers. It allows us to work with large groups of children successfully. The balls are slower and coloured and different sizes. Come and enjoy with us. It is also most beneficial for beginner adults.

ITA is Moving   01.05.2008
The ITA is moving to bigger and better premises only 3.7km away. It is all very exciting and we will all benefit from the new facilities. We will be the new coaches at the Pirates Tennis Club on the corner of Cruden Bay road and Braeside avenue in Greenside. Pirates Tennis Club has 100 members with leagues, 10 tennis courts including 2 floodlit courts. They run social tennis on Wednesday afternoons, Thursday afternoons, public holidays and Saturday afternoons. Leagues are on Sunday mornings usually. The main club has 1000 members with cricket, soccer, rugby, hockey, squash, baseball, bowls, dancing, road running, cycling, a summer pool, a small gymn (privately run) and a small shop and pub with weekly draws, function venues and more!!!!! We will move from Melpark on 1 May and start coaching there on Saturday 3 May. The entrance is on Cruden Bay road, no.4. The parking is on the corner of Cruden Bay and Braeside and the clubhouse is below the parking adjacent to the 2 floodlit courts.
